Mastering Networking Events for Maximum Impact
Stepping into a networking event can feel like entering a bustling ocean of faces. But fear not! By embracing a few key strategies, you can transform this environment to build meaningful connections that fuel your growth. Start by clarifying your goals. What are you hoping to achieve? Once you have a defined vision, polish your elevator pitch – a concise and engaging summary of who you are and what you offer.
,Beyond this, boldly approach individuals sparking conversations with genuine curiosity. Listen attentively, ask thoughtful questions, and express a true interest in their experiences. Remember, networking is a two-way street – it's about fostering mutually beneficial relationships.
- Connect with individuals from diverse backgrounds and industries.
- Exchange your expertise and insights willingly.
- Stay connected after the event to strengthen those connections.
,In essence, by approaching networking events with a positive mindset, preparation, and genuine interest in others, you can unlock their potential for growth.
